Burning fedora files to dvd

I've downloaded the dvd iso files for fedora but i cant figure out how to burn them to a dvd. Any suggestions???

Here's how I burn my Linux ISO's:
1. Download. (duh)
2. Use Daemon Tools to mount the ISO into a virtual DVD-ROM drive. Here for more info.
3. Use Nero Express and use the option to just copy a disk from another DVD drive. (In this case your virtual drive with the ISO mounted.)
And done.

Nero can burn Images, so there is no need to load them into the emulator first.
